Security Alert: DSS Warns Of More Bomb Explosions In Public Places
0
SHARES
0
VIEWS
Share on FacebookShare on Twitter

The Department of State Services (DSS) has issued an alert to the nation over renewed plots by criminal elements to create more chaos in the country by using improvised explosive devices, IED, to bomb public places in the country.

The Spokesman for the DSS, Dr. Peter Afunanya, made the statement available to journalists on Tuesday, stating that the miscreants were plotting to return Nigeria to the pre-2015 era when they bombed both soft and hard targets in parts of the country.

The statement also noted that though there are already reported cases of such incidents in some areas, the Service has uncovered a ploy by suspected criminal gangs to forge an alliance among themselves with a view to launching further attacks on critical infrastructure and other frequented public places like worship and relaxation centres, especially during and after the holidays and festive celebrations.The statement further added that the objective of the planned attacks, is to achieve some self- serving interests as well as cause fear among the citizenry.

“Following these, patrons, owners and managers of aforementioned public places are advised to be wary of this development and implement basic security measures to deter the threats. While the Service is committed to the disruption of this trend and pattern of violent attacks, it will continue to partner with other security agencies to ensure that necessary drills are emplaced in order that public peace and order are not jeopardized.”

They however asked citizens to go about their lawful businesses while sharing useful information on the activities of criminals at their disposal with security and law enforcement agencies.
